Transaction 05e25b90a2794a500dcf6bde4afb36513f7aef3e0c04f399f52db51e8ff58974

1 Input
2 Outputs
  • 05e25b90a2794a500dcf6bde4afb36513f7aef3e0c04f399f52db51e8ff58974:0
  • value  1530228
    address  3QNsnhzgiZpxZRgwhgoaw2VvaYK9jzGoTu
  • 05e25b90a2794a500dcf6bde4afb36513f7aef3e0c04f399f52db51e8ff58974:1
  • value  11967136
    address  34U5tWiRorsmixM73FDYWLC2hNbRDLBMWi